The 2011 Season
(SWB) Yankees president, Kristen Rose, describes the promotions and giveaways as comparable to the 2010 season. This year they are being announced well in advance so fans know what to expect.
The 2011 promotions announced last week have the theme "Party like a champ," and are concentrated on the weekends when people have most of their free time. The following programs were announced:
* Post game fireworks will follow 12 games at PNC Field, and that is two more than last year.
* Giveaways are planned at five different games for the first 2,00 fans that go through the gate.
* Live entertainment during selected games.
* Theme nights featuring outstanding local, national, and international organizations.
The Great Deal
There will be seven Friends and Family Nights with Wendys. Fans will get four game tickets, four hats and four Wendy's value meals. Believe it or not, that is a $140 value for just $29.95!
Source: David Singleton, SWB Yanks promotions tilt heavily to weekends, The Citizens Voice, March 21, 2011.
